Materials
- Pencil
- Drawing Paper
- Crayons or Colored Pencils
- Black Marker (optional)
- How to Draw a Pirate Map Printable PDF (see bottom of lesson)

Outline The Map
Outline the pirate map by making a rectangular shape with jagged edges.
-
Draw The Water And Landforms
First, draw blob shapes to create the landforms. Then, draw two bumpy horizontal lines to draw the water.
-
Form The Hull
Form the hull of the pirate ship by drawing the shape as shown. Add details to the ship’s hull by making horizontal lines.
-
Attach The Mast And Sail
Attach the mast of the pirate ship by drawing a long thin vertical rectangle. Next, draw the sail by creating a rectangular shape as shown. Now, form the jolly roger on the sail by outlining the skull with rounded shapes.
-
Mark The Treasure
Let’s mark the treasure on the map! First, draw an X-shape. Next, form the treasure chest as shown. Then, draw dashed lines to create the path.
-
Outline The Map Compass
Outline the map compass by drawing a vertical and horizontal line. Make sure to draw a small X-shaped line as shown too!
-
Form The Shape Of The Compass
Using the outline as a guide, form the shape of the compass with straight lines.
-
Write The Directions
Let’s write the directions on the map compass. Write “N” for north, “W” for West, “S” for South and “E” for East.
-
Complete The Pirate Map Drawing
Let’s complete the pirate map drawing! First, color the edges of the map with a brown crayon then gradually transition to blue. Next, color the landforms with green crayons. Now, color the hull of the pirate ship and the treasure chest with a brown crayon. Use an orange crayon to fill in the compass, the details on the treasure chest and the mast of the pirate ship. Finally, color the sail with a purple crayon and the skull with a white crayon.
